WATCH: BMC Demolishes Uddhav Thackeray Sena Faction's Bandra East Office

Mumbai civic body,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C), on Thursday demolished Uddhav Thackeray Shiv Sena camp's Bandra East office in the Nirmal Nagar area citing it as "illegal".

This comes just days after ED raided a close associate of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Aaditya Thackeray in the BMC field hospital for a Covid scam case.

Video by the news agency PTI showed bulldozers in action while people gathered at the location. Police officials were also present at the site during the demolition.

Reacting to the demolition of the Shakha,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Arvind Sawant told PTI, "People are watching how the (Maharashtra) government is acting with hatred and malice."

Earlier on Wednesday, Mumbai Police downgraded the security of Shiv Sena (UBT) chief Uddhav Thackeray, his wife Rashmi, and son Aaditya. According to an official, police removed extra vehicles from the security convoys of Uddhav Thackeray and his family.

As per a Sena (UBT) functionary, the security outside 'Matoshree', the family residence of Thackeray in suburban Bandra, has been reduced too. However, police said that there has been "no downgrading" of any protected person's security.

According to a police official, Mumbai Police had provided an additional vehicle each for the security convoys accompanying former Maharashtra chief minister Uddhav Thackeray, his wife Rashmi, and his son, former minister Aaditya.

These additional vehicles have been removed, he said, without specifying the reason. The news agency stated that Uddhav Thackeray enjoys Z+ security while Aaditya has Y+ security cover.

A party official claimed that besides removing extra vehicles, the deployment of security personnel outside 'Matoshree' has also been reduced.

But a police statement clarified that there has been "no withdrawal or downgrading in the scale of security of any categorised protected person residing within the jurisdictional limit of Mumbai Police."
